LTB Order for Eviction Due to Non-payment of Rent

Case LTB-L-024512-22 - Ranee Management vs. Ezroy Bernard

🕑 Case timeline

Application Date: Date not provided

Hearing Date: January 4, 2023

Order Issued: January 16, 2023

Termination Date: January 31, 2023

Eviction Deadline: January 31, 2023

ℹ️ Case overview

Case Number: LTB-L-024512-22
Address: 1017, 165 Kennedy Rd S, Brampton, ON L6W 3L3
Form Used: N4 Notice
Served By: Landlord
Amount Awarded: $625.04 plus daily compensation of $59.03 starting January 5, 2023
Decision In Favor: Landlord
Application Type: Eviction for non-payment of rent
RTA Sections: Section 69, Subsection 83(1)(b), Subsection 83(2), Section 74(11)

👥 Parties involved

Landlord: Ranee Management
Landlord Rep: Ilana Glickman
Tenant: Ezroy Bernard
Tenant Rep: Renee Wittter
Adjudicator: Greg Brocanier
Keywords: eviction, non-payment of rent, N4 notice, rent arrears

⚖️ Decision summary

Tenancy terminated unless tenant voids the order by payment.
Tenant must vacate by January 31, 2023 if not voiding the order.
Daily compensation owed for continued occupation.

⚠️ Dispute summary

Landlord seeks eviction for unpaid rent.
Tenant has opportunity to void eviction by paying full arrears.

📑 Findings & determinations

Valid N4 notice served.
Tenant still in possession of unit as of hearing date.
Tenant owes $3,722.80 in rent arrears as of January 31, 2023.

💡 Summary points

Tenant failed to pay rent leading to eviction notice.
Hearing conducted via videoconference.
Tenant can void eviction by paying specified amounts.
